Coastal Color Palettes

Soft Blues and Seafoam Greens
In 2024, coastal color palettes are embracing the calming hues of the ocean. Soft blues and seafoam greens create a serene atmosphere that complements the natural beauty of coastal settings. These colors bring a refreshing and tranquil vibe to interiors, making them perfect for living rooms, bedrooms, and bathrooms.

Warm Sand and Driftwood Tones
Warm sand and driftwood tones are gaining popularity for their ability to evoke the feeling of sun-kissed shores. These neutral shades add warmth and sophistication to coastal homes, providing a versatile backdrop that pairs beautifully with both modern and traditional furnishings.

Bold Accents of Coral and Turquoise
For a touch of vibrancy, bold accents of coral and turquoise are making waves in coastal design. These lively colors can be used in decorative accessories, artwork, or even feature walls to add a pop of color and a sense of playfulness to your home.

Luxurious Materials

Sustainable and Natural Materials
Sustainability continues to be a key trend, with a focus on natural and eco-friendly materials. Reclaimed wood, bamboo, and recycled glass are not only stylish but also environmentally conscious choices. These materials add character and a sense of authenticity to your coastal home while supporting green building practices.

Elegant Marble and Quartz
Marble and quartz are timeless materials that add an air of sophistication to any space. In coastal homes, white and light-colored marbles are popular for countertops and backsplashes, reflecting natural light and enhancing the sense of openness. Quartz, with its durability and variety of colors, offers a low-maintenance alternative with a luxurious finish.

Textured Finishes
Textured finishes, such as shiplap walls and woven rattan, are trending for their ability to add depth and visual interest. Incorporating these textures into your home’s design creates a layered look that complements the relaxed yet refined coastal aesthetic.

Architectural Styles

 Modern Coastal
Modern coastal architecture emphasizes clean lines, open spaces, and a seamless connection between indoor and outdoor living. Large windows and sliding glass doors maximize natural light and offer unobstructed views of the ocean. Rooflines are often simple and streamlined, contributing to the contemporary feel of the design.

Mediterranean Revival
The Mediterranean Revival style is making a comeback, with its emphasis on elegant arches, wrought iron details, and terracotta tiles. This style brings a touch of old-world charm to coastal homes, blending beautifully with the coastal landscape and creating a sophisticated yet inviting atmosphere.

Coastal Farmhouse
The coastal farmhouse style combines rustic charm with coastal elegance. Expect to see features like exposed wooden beams, wide plank floors, and charming porches that invite relaxation. This style is perfect for creating a welcoming and comfortable home that embodies the laid-back coastal lifestyle.

Outdoor Living Spaces

 Expansive Decks and Patios
Outdoor living spaces are a central focus in coastal design, with expansive decks and patios designed to maximize outdoor enjoyment. Think spacious areas for dining, lounging, and entertaining, complete with stylish outdoor furniture and built-in features like fire pits and outdoor kitchens.

 Infinity Pools and Spa Areas
Infinity pools and spa areas are the ultimate luxury for coastal homes. These features not only enhance the visual appeal of your property but also offer a tranquil retreat where you can unwind while enjoying panoramic views of the ocean.

Lush Landscaping
Lush landscaping is key to creating a cohesive and inviting outdoor environment. Tropical plants, manicured lawns, and thoughtfully designed garden areas enhance the beauty of your coastal home and provide a seamless transition between your indoor and outdoor spaces.
